`
赵大帅
  • 浏览: 5451 次
  • 性别: Icon_minigender_1
  • 来自: 北京
社区版块
存档分类
最新评论

百度地图API-显示地图

 
阅读更多

现在互联网上使用地图或定位的程序越来越多,网站上如果想使用地图或定位功能的话可以使用Google Map 或百度Map,当然,前者在中国大陆是无法使用的,推荐使用后者,当然,百度Map也是比较不错的,API是非常完善的,足够我们处理日常的业务。下面介绍下简单的百度Map相关的API。

首先要去下面的地址去申请一个百度Key,只要有百度账号即可。申请好的Key就是我们一会在引入js时所需要用到的ak

地址如下:http://developer.baidu.com/map/ 

到下面有申请密钥,点击,然后会让登录,输入百度账号密码登录。申请密钥必须是百度开发者,如果不是的话那么需要注册一下,步骤比较简单,页面会自己跳转到百度开发者的注册平台,按步骤注册即可。如果已经是的话,点击申请密钥的时候他会自动跳转的。具体的步骤记不太清楚了。总之步骤不难。

如果你是百度开发者的话,那么在LBS开放平台下你能够找到开发选项,在这里面有很多API和提供给我们使用如下图所示

进去后,可以在左边的导航中找到实例DEMO,所有的DEMO都在里面的,个人认为,看DEMO学习会比较快一点。

在这里简单先介绍下如何使用百度地图

第一步:导入百度地图API , 在页面上通过<script>标签引入百度API

 

<script type="text/javascript" src="http://api.map.baidu.com/api?v=2.0&ak=您的密钥"></script>

 

   参数 v 指的是使用的版本 , 2.0 要比1.0多很多东西,当然也删除了一些东西

   参数 ak 就是刚才申请的密钥,不同类别的密钥功能也不同。

第二步:使用百度MapAPI

<body>
	<div id="allmap"></div>
</body>
</html>
<script type="text/javascript">
	// 百度地图API功能
	var map = new BMap.Map("allmap");    // 创建Map实例
	map.centerAndZoom(new BMap.Point(116.404, 39.915), 11);  // 初始化地图,设置中心点坐标和地图级别
	map.enableScrollWheelZoom(true);     //开启鼠标滚轮缩放
</script>

 现在可以去页面中看看效果了,一个简单的地图就出来了,能够通过滚路的滚动实现地图放大或缩小。

简单介绍下API

BMap : 构造函数,必须通过BMap函数来创建地图

Map(id) : 显示地图的容器ID

centerAndZoom(Point,Scale) : 设置地图的中心点,Point为经纬度 , 也可以写城市名称,比如北京 ,Scale是缩放的比例 ,通常情况下3-18足够用

enableScrollWheelZoom(true) : 启用滚轮实现地图缩放。

 

  • 大小: 226.4 KB
分享到:
评论

相关推荐

    基于百度地图API -- 周边POI搜索

    本项目关注的是“基于百度地图API的周边POI(Point of Interest)搜索”,这是一个典型的地理定位与信息检索应用场景,主要涉及到Android平台上的开发。下面将详细阐述相关知识点: 1. **百度地图API**:百度地图...

    Android 百度地图API-定位周边搜索POI源码.rar

    通过分析和学习这个源码,开发者可以掌握如何在Android应用中整合百度地图API,实现实时定位、显示地图以及搜索周边POI等功能。同时,源码中的注释和逻辑处理对于提升地图API的运用技巧大有裨益。

    百度地图api-ak

    申请百度地图的api密钥,大家做地图api开发可以使用,关于api可以多交流

    Android源码——百度地图API-定位周边搜索POI源码.7z

    在Android开发中,百度地图API是一个非常重要的工具,它提供了丰富的功能,如定位、路径规划、地图展示等。本文将详细解析"Android源码——百度地图API-定位周边搜索POI源码.7z"中涉及的关键知识点,帮助开发者更好...

    Android源码——百度地图API-定位周边搜索POI源码.zip

    在Android开发中,百度地图API是一个非常常用的服务,它提供了丰富的功能,如定位、地图展示、路线规划、周边搜索等。这份"Android源码——百度地图API-定位周边搜索POI源码.zip"包含了实现这些功能的具体源代码,...

    Android代码-百度地图API-定位周边搜索POI源码.zip

    在Android开发中,百度地图API是一个非常重要的工具,它提供了丰富的功能,如定位、地图展示、路线规划等。本源码主要关注的是如何利用百度地图API实现定位并搜索周边的Point of Interest(POI),即兴趣点。这些...

    Android百度地图API-定位周边搜索POI源码.zip

    在Android开发中,百度地图API是一个非常重要的工具,它提供了丰富的功能,如定位、地图展示、路线规划、周边搜索等,极大地便利了开发者构建地图相关的应用程序。本源码压缩包"Android百度地图API-定位周边搜索POI...

    安卓GPS地图导航定位指南相关-Android百度地图API-定位周边搜索POI源码.rar

    本资源“安卓GPS地图导航定位指南相关-Android百度地图API-定位周边搜索POI源码.rar”提供了基于百度地图API实现的定位和周边搜索功能的源码,可以帮助开发者更好地理解和运用这些技术。 首先,我们要了解什么是GPS...

    小程序源码 地图相关 百度地图API-定位周边搜索POI源码.rar

    该压缩包文件“小程序源码 地图相关 百度地图API-定位周边搜索POI源码.rar”包含了使用百度地图API开发的小程序源码,主要用于实现定位功能以及周边搜索POI(Point of Interest)的功能。这个源码适用于开发者想要在...

    Android 百度地图API-定位周边搜索POI源码.7z

    总之,"Android 百度地图API-定位周边搜索POI源码"这个项目涵盖了Android与百度地图API的深度集成,包括定位、地图显示、POI搜索等多个关键功能。通过学习和研究这个源码,开发者可以更好地理解和运用百度地图API,...

    Android百度地图API-定位周边

    在Android开发中,百度地图API是一个非常重要的工具,它提供了丰富的功能,如定位、地图展示、路线规划等。本文将详细讲解如何利用百度地图API在Android应用中实现定位及周边搜索POI(Point of Interest)的功能。 ...

    调用百度地图API显示虚线运动轨迹

    本文将深入探讨如何利用百度地图API来显示虚线运动轨迹。百度地图API提供了丰富的功能,包括地图展示、定位、路线规划以及自定义标注等。对于初次接触百度地图API的开发者,通过实例学习是快速上手的有效途径。 ...

    Android 百度地图API-定位周边搜索POI源码.zip项目安卓应用源码下载

    Android 百度地图API-定位周边搜索POI源码.zip项目安卓应用源码下载Android 百度地图API-定位周边搜索POI源码.zip项目安卓应用源码下载 1.适合学生毕业设计研究参考 2.适合个人学习研究参考 3.适合公司开发项目技术...

    利用百度地图API实现在地图车辆的平滑移动,轨迹回放,多台车辆同时平滑移动

    1. **百度地图API**:百度地图API是百度公司提供的一套Web服务接口,允许开发者在其网站或应用中嵌入地图功能,包括地图显示、定位、路径规划等。通过JavaScript API,开发者可以轻松地与百度地图进行交互,创建丰富...

    Android程序研发源码百度地图API-定位周边搜索POI源码.zip

    在Android应用程序开发中,使用百度地图API是一种常见的实践,它为开发者提供了丰富的地图功能,如定位、导航、周边搜索和兴趣点(POI)查询等。这个压缩包"Android程序研发源码百度地图API-定位周边搜索POI源码.zip...

    Android 百度地图API-定位周边搜索POI源码.zip

    在Android开发中,百度地图API是一个非常重要的工具,它提供了丰富的功能,如定位、路径规划、地图展示等。本资源“Android 百度地图API-定位周边搜索POI源码.zip”显然是一份完整的源码示例,专门针对Android平台上...

    百度地图API显示多个标注点信息

    本文将深入探讨如何使用百度地图API显示多个标注点,并结合jQuery库来优化用户体验。 首先,百度地图API(Baidu Maps API)是百度公司提供的一项免费服务,它允许开发者在其网站上集成地图功能,包括定位、地图展示...

    百度地图API使用系列2-显示地图在手机界面

    百度地图API使用的简单介绍的系列博客2-显示百度地图在手机界面上面

Global site tag (gtag.js) - Google Analytics